A boat has an angle of depression of 38° looking down to a submarine. The distance from the
boat to the submarine is 500 yards. How far below sea level is the submarine?

Answer: 307.8 yards

Step-by-step explanation:

Hi, since the situation forms a right triangle (see attachment) we have to apply the next trigonometric function.  

Sin α = opposite side / hypotenuse  

Where α is the angle of depression of the boat looking down to a submarine, the hypotenuse is the distance from the boat to the submarine, and the opposite side (x) is the distance between the submarine and the sea level:

Replacing with the values given:  

Sin 38 = x/ 500

Solving for x  

Sin 38 (500) =x  

x= 307.8 yards
